Editor's Notes
"Herewith forwarded specimens of "Maca[--]tat" Elaeis guineensis (Oil Palm) as promised ## I am also glad to inform you that the variety of Bamboo that you require is to be found growing in Panama The Bambusa Vulgaris however I will still try to find out if it grows in this island" Marginalia by Charles F. Hanington: "The fibers are in [----] -- Have not seen them before this because of the difficulty in finishing the forms"
